Output df5958c346616a3082253d3178f829a610cba238aa03e8d0a9c29e47c1483441:358

value
43038
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4a66669684cd1a7fcb625ebafc3abe7f9e1b6b06 OP_EQUALVERIFY OP_CHECKSIG
address
17nPg89SYU1EuETHzKHv3E47dCVh46DW96
transaction
df5958c346616a3082253d3178f829a610cba238aa03e8d0a9c29e47c1483441
confirmations
457922
spent
true